Output e687573901b1c533be8835bae95aa6ef579847ae35495e974b5da123c92df2f3:0

value
58098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57324f4de8b0eb3d0ea4dfc7caed942dc8eb55a5 OP_EQUAL
address
39e4ypPv5FApPhz9fKXpmXgk6jFg66e8E1
transaction
e687573901b1c533be8835bae95aa6ef579847ae35495e974b5da123c92df2f3
spent
true